Kinetic energy dependence of fission fragment isomeric ratios for spherical nuclei 132Sn

2017 
Abstract Isomeric ratios are a powerful observable to investigate fission fragment total angular momenta. A recent experimental campaign achieved at the LOHENGRIN spectrometer, shows a kinetic energy dependence of μ s isomeric ratios from fission fragments populated in neutron induced fission of 235 U. For the first time, this dependence was measured for the isomeric ratio of the doubly magic 132 Sn. A Bayesian assessment of the angular momentum distribution of 132 Sn is proposed according to calculations performed with the FIFRELIN code and interpreted with spin generation models.
